For the 2026 school year, there are 3 private elementary schools serving 2,174 students in 47150, IN.
The top-ranked private elementary schools in 47150, IN include Holy Family School, Our Lady Of Perpetual Help School, and Christian Academy of Indiana.
The average acceptance rate is 70%, which is lower than the Indiana private elementary school average acceptance rate of 83%.
